IP65 provides total dust-tight sealing and protection from water jets. IP66 and above offer even higher resilience, critical for exposed outdoor deployments. Choosing the Right IP for the Environment Mild climates with shelter: IP54 may suffice. Open-air installations: IP65 prevents dust buildup. . Understanding its Role in Modern Energy Solutions A Container Battery Energy Storage System (BESS) refers to a modular, scalable energy storage solution that houses batteries, power electronics, and control systems within a standardized shipping container.
